macrognathia

abnormally large jaw Etiology: - hereditary - pituitary gigantism - acromegaly - Paget's disease of bone (osteitis deformans) - leontiasis ossea Clinical manifestations: - mandibular protrusion (when mandible is affected) - 'gummy smile' (when maxilla is affected) - chin may appear prominent (when mandible is affected) Management: - surgery: osteotomy
